About

Shigeru Shimoda is a pioneering researcher in the field of intelligent robotic camera systems, with a specific focus on automating the complex, artistic techniques of professional broadcast cameramen. His work sits at the intersection of robotics, computer vision, and human-machine interaction, aiming to replicate the nuanced visual storytelling of human operators. Shimoda’s major contributions include the development of control algorithms that translate expert cameramen’s manual techniques—such as smooth zooming and subject tracking—into automated commands for a robot camera. In his foundational studies, such as "Automatic control of a robot camera for broadcasting" (2000) and "Study of Zooming Measurement Method" (1999), he designed and experimentally validated methods to analyze and reproduce the subjective quality of human-shot footage.
